Why this role is important to us
This role is critical to the success of Core data projects as it ensures the development of high-quality, user-friendly, and scalable UI solutions. A dedicated UI-focused senior developer to translate business and functional requirements into intuitive interfaces, improving overall user experience and adoption. By reporting directly to the Assistant Vice President, the role also enables faster decision-making, better alignment with project goals, and timely delivery of UI components, ultimately contributing to the efficiency, consistency, and visual integrity of SSCD applications.
What you will be responsible for
- Lead the design, development, and delivery of complex UI applications using ReactJS and modern frontend technologies, ensuring scalability, performance, and maintainability.
- Define and enforce frontend architecture, design patterns, and coding standards, promoting best practices across UI development teams.
- Collaborate closely with Product Owners, UX designers, backend teams and business stakeholders to translate requirements into robust technical solutions.
- Provide technical leadership and mentorship to UI developers, conducting code reviews, design reviews, and guiding the team on ReactJS best practices.
- Drive adoption of modern UI frameworks, component libraries, and tools (e.g., React, MUI, state management, build tools).
- Oversee UI performance optimization, accessibility, responsiveness and cross‑browser compatibility.
- Ensure high code quality through automated testing, unit testing strategies, CI/CD integration, and adherence to development standards.
- Participate in Agile ceremonies including sprint planning, backlog grooming, reviews, and retrospectives, contributing to delivery commitments.
- Identify technical risks and bottlenecks, propose solutions, and take ownership of technical decision‑making.
- Coordinate with global teams and stakeholders to ensure on‑time, high‑quality delivery and alignment with overall project and business goals.
What we value
These skills will help you succeed in this role
• SDLC, Agile & Requirement Analysis
Strong understanding of the Software Development Life Cycle (SDLC) with hands‑on experience in Agile methodologies. Ability to analyze business requirements and functional specifications and translate them into effective technical solutions.
• UI & Backend Technical Expertise
Extensive experience in UI development using HTML, CSS, JavaScript, ReactJS, and MUI, along with solid backend knowledge in Java and REST APIs. Good understanding of databases and PL/SQL is an added advantage.
• System Design, Data Structures & Code Quality
Strong grasp of data structures and algorithms, enabling the development of efficient, scalable, and maintainable applications. Ensures adherence to coding standards, best practices, and performance optimization.
• Version Control & Cross‑Team Collaboration
Solid understanding of Git features and workflows. Proven ability to coordinate with cross‑regional teams, work independently, and collaborate effectively as part of a global development team.
• Leadership, Communication & Ownership
Excellent communication, analytical, and problem‑solving skills. Demonstrate high levels of dedication, accountability, and commitment toward delivering quality outcomes and supporting team success.

Education & Preferred Qualifications
• Bachelor’s Degree with Computer science background.
• 8+ years of SDLC experience, developing UI solutions
• Experience working with cross-functional and globally distributed teams
Work Requirement
• This role requires adherence to State Street India’s work‑from‑office policy and is not eligible for a fully remote arrangement.
